Welcome to IMSO Architecture
You’ll be part of the Infrastructure Architecture team where you, together with your colleagues, will be responsible for design, cost calculations, and coordination of deliveries from the other teams within the Infrastructure Management & Service Operations department.
You’ll play an important role in:
- driving and participating in developing our infrastructure architecture standards and design
- participating in projects or ARTs as the person bridging business, operations requirements, and vendor specifications while still upholding our infrastructure standards
- being the liaison between the project and the infrastructure department once the project moves into the execution phase, ensuring that we deliver on time and on budget
- being responsible for ensuring proper handover to operation, including verifying that all project deliveries are in place so we can ensure stable operation
- supporting strategy projects and tasks.
To succeed in the role, you:
- have designed and implemented IT infrastructure as an architect
- have experience with most of the common infrastructure technologies (storage, network, compute, and cloud) and have hands-on experience with infrastructure operations
- can combine IT with business projects and act as the central point between IT and the business
- are a flexible colleague willing to chip in where competences and necessity require you to do so
- get things done and get others to do what is expected of them
- have either a formal, higher technical education or a master’s degree within the field of IT.
